Also, we got some more games in the bundle that aren’t repeats. Yea!

Don’t Stand Out (11.99)– A battle-royale game, but from a top down perspective. Just like most games in these bundles, almost no one is playing it. I played one match, and instantly got killed by another player who had a grenade. Yeah, I didn’t like it.

Space Pilgrim (1.99)– A RPG maker game, that’s not an RPG. Look, I’m not going to sugar coat this. RPG Maker games just feel cheap to me… and yes, sadly this is one that feels like one. I don’t know if any of the assets are reused or what, but some of the menus look like their weren’t changed around too much. One of the weaker entries of the bundle. Sorry. Also, it’s only the first part of a larger series. I think I know what this bundle holds for me in the future.

Sure Footing (9.99)– An endless runner where you run and jump. It was okay- deaths felt really cheap, though- especially since you can move your character left or right. It’s only okay.

FINAL VERDICT– Wow. After days of decent games, I think this bundle is starting to lose it’s steam. I think I only liked Sure Footing. The other two were just….. meh. I would say that they need to get better, but I have feeling that soon, we’ll really get something truly awful! You ain’t seen nothing yet! 2/5
